The ordinary gear system shown consists of bevel gears, spur gears and a worm gear. Determine the overall speed ratio (i_27 or i_total). If n_2= 1200 rpm (CCW), find the magnitude and the direction for the angular velocity of gear 7. If the distance between shafts 2 and 3 =210 mm, calculate the module, the radii of pitch circles R_2, R_3, addendum, and dedendum for gears 2 and 3.Solution
Solution:
Taking teeth on gear as T2 = 18 ; T3 =36 ; T4 = 10 ; T5 = 20 ; T6 = 1 ; T7 = 4
Gear Ratio is given by product of Teeth of driven gears/product of teeth of driver gears
GR = T3 x T5 xT7/ (T2 x T4 x T6)
GR = 36 x 20 x 4 / (18 x 10 x 1)
= 16
GR is also equal to angular velocity of input/output
16 = 1200/angular velocity gear 7
angular velocity gear 9 = 75 rpm
